Latin Grammys Unveil 2025 Date, Set to Return to Las Vegas

The Latin Recording Academy announced Tuesday (April 22) that the 26th annual Latin Grammy Awards will be held Thursday, Nov. 13, at the MGM Grand Garden Arena in Las Vegas. This marks the 15th time that the ceremony will be held in Sin City.

Most recently, the awards ceremony had been held outside of Las Vegas. In 2023, the Latin Recording Academy hosted Latin Grammys week in Seville, Spain. Last year, it was held in Miami.

“We are proud to once again bring the passion and creativity of Latin music to Las Vegas,” Manuel Abud, CEO of the Latin Recording Academy, said in a press statement. “The city has welcomed the Latin Grammys over the years, and we look forward to another great Latin Grammy Week celebrating Latin music and its creators.”

The three-hour telecast will be produced by TelevisaUnivision and will air across TelevisaUnivision’s U.S. platforms, beginning at 8 p.m. ET, preceded by a one-hour pre-show starting at 7 p.m. ET.

“As the home of Latin music, we are excited to deliver unparalleled coverage of the 26th annual Latin GRAMMY Awards to our audience,” added Ignacio Meyer, president of Univision Networks Group at TelevisaUnivision. “This iconic night will showcase the extraordinary talent in Latin music, while shining a spotlight on the visionary artists, creators, and stories that are shaping culture in the U.S. and around the globe.”

Furthermore, nominations will be announced on Sept. 17, with the final round of voting taking place Oct. 1-13.
